YOUTH - TRANSFERS Loris Tinelli, a 19-year-old Luxembourger from the U19 selection of Anderlecht, will play for Virton next season. That reports the Luxembourg newspaper Tageblatt. The midfielder played for Anderlecht for three years, but could not break through.


Last season, Tinelli played three games in the UEFA Youth League. He was allowed to start in the first game at Bayern Munich and fell in against PSG and Celtic. At Anderlecht, however, he had no future and so his expiring contract was not renewed.

Virton, who plays in the first amateurs division, already strengthened itself with former Anderlecht player Mohammed Soumaré. The 22-year-old player comes over from Avellino, which has sent him on loan to the Luxembourg champion Dudelange for the past six months.
